Output d0023d6bbda705667bfafb6ca4fc158e5bdc63ee3327c415412af4ea28e382de:0

value
515954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b950403e0767a8f138058703da30a2845928b7 OP_EQUAL
address
3998etUgEtqynY5Sy8Afh739y2CHQbrYwQ
transaction
d0023d6bbda705667bfafb6ca4fc158e5bdc63ee3327c415412af4ea28e382de
confirmations
346852
spent
true